The Impact of Wickets
The loss of Ishan Mulchandani, caught by Anish Chaudhary off Vaibhav Mali's bowling, was a significant moment. Mulchandani had been in fine form, with a well-crafted 65 runs from 45 deliveries. His departure changed the dynamic of the game, as the Falcons now had to rebuild their innings.
